Not able to find your fellow poets' posts? Here is one way to set up tabs to follow favourite hashtags and poetry communities:

1/ swipe right until you have the 'Following' tab on the left at the top.

What a difference a day makes...in the life of a shaggy inkcap, or lawyers wig (here with its two junior acolytes).
November 10, 2025 at 10:58 AM
In the garden this morning, Coprinus comatus, commonly known as the shaggy ink cap, lawyer's wig, or shaggy mane. The barrister and their two articled clerks?

I've stepped into the reading of comfortable fiction "neither literary nor too commercial".

Persephone Books, Bath, is a publisher of "largely forgotten 20th century novels by (mostly) women writers".

This week I'm reading...'Someone at a Distance' by Dorothy Whipple, ordered from Read, Holmfirth.
